If your topic view starts to look like this:
And you don't know why... then you've most likely switched to the outline view without knowing it.
To correct this problem simply click on the Standard hyperlink as shown in the picture.
Your topic view should now be corrected.

what's the difference between standard and linear
QUOTE(Vice King @ May 31 2005, 21:51)
what's the difference between standard and linear
[right][snapback]585997540[/snapback][/right]
Linear keeps the initial post at the top at all times which is great for large threads that go off topic.
